Direct comparison of every spec from each device profile.
| Specification | DynaVap The G3 | XVape Fog Pro |
|---|---|---|
| Price (USD) | $35 | $120 |
| Device Type | Portable | Portable |
| Heating Type | Hybrid | Convection |
| Heat Up Time | ~5-7 seconds with a torch | ~15 seconds |
| Temperature Range | N/A | 100-220℃ (212-428℉) |
| Chamber Capacity | 0.05g (fixed) | ~0.3 grams |
| Battery Type | None | 18650 |
| Battery Capacity | N/A | 3200mAh |
| Battery Life | N/A | — |
| Charging | N/A | USB-C |
| Charge Time | N/A | — |
| Dimensions | ~75x10mm | — |
| Power Adjustment | Manual | Digtal |
| Chamber Material | Glass | Stainless Steel |
| Concentrate Support | — | Yes |
| Brand | DynaVap | XVape |
| Adjustable Airflow | Yes, via the airport (no condenser) | No |
| Body Material | Glass unibody with a stainless steel Captive Cap | — |
| Country of Manufacture | United States (USA) | China |
| Haptic Feedback | — | Yes |
| Manufacturer | DynaVap LLC | TopGreen Technology Co |
| Release Date | 2025 | 2021 |
| Replaceable Battery | — | Yes |
| Session Style | On-Demand | Session |
| Warranty | 90 day satisfaction guarantee, glass is not covered for life | 1 year |
| Water Pipe Adapter | None, the unibody is not tapered | — |
The biggest practical difference is heating approach: DynaVap The G3 runs hybrid while XVape Fog Pro runs convection. That changes flavor delivery, vapor density, and how the device responds to slow versus fast draws.
DynaVap The G3 is the cheaper option at $35 compared with $120 for the XVape Fog Pro, about $85 less. Live retailer pricing can shift, so confirm before buying.
DynaVap The G3 reaches session-ready temperature in ~5-7 seconds with a torch, while the XVape Fog Pro takes ~15 seconds. That's roughly 9 seconds quicker on the DynaVap The G3, which is useful if you want shorter, on-demand sessions.
DynaVap The G3 uses hybrid heating, while the XVape Fog Pro uses convection. Heating style influences flavor profile, vapor density, and how forgiving the device is to draw technique.
XVape Fog Pro has the larger chamber at ~0.3 grams, versus 0.05g (fixed) on the DynaVap The G3. A bigger bowl means fewer reloads on long sessions; a smaller one suits microdosing and quicker bowls.
